Overview of Metal Roofing



Steel roof has actually gained appeal in recent years as a result of its durability and aesthetic appeal. When you choose steel roof covering, you're selecting a product that can stand up to rough weather, including heavy rain, snow, and high winds.

Unlike standard roof shingles, metal ro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years with very little upkeep, making them a long-lasting investment.

An additional advantage of steel roofing is its energy performance. You'll locate that lots of metal roofings are developed to mirror solar heat, which can help in reducing your cooling expenses throughout warm summertime.


Plus, steel roof coverings are usually made from recycled materials, which interest environmentally conscious homeowners.

In regards to layout, metal roofing comes in various styles, colors, and finishes, enabling you to personalize your home's appearance. Whether you prefer a sleek modern-day appearance or a rustic charm, you'll have options to match your vision.

Ultimately, metal roofing is resistant to pests and rot, providing you assurance that your roofing system will stay undamaged over the years.

With all these advantages, it's not surprising that lots of property owners are making the switch to steel roof.

Secret Comparisons and Considerations



Selecting in between steel and roof shingles roof entails numerous essential comparisons and considerations that can substantially affect your decision.

First, think of longevity. Steel ro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t roof shingles typically last 15 to 30 years. This longevity suggests that although steel may have a greater upfront expense, it can save you money over time.

Next, think about maintenance. Steel roofing systems call for much less maintenance, resisting mold and mold, while shingles could require much more frequent maintenances.

Appearances likewise contribute. Shingles supply a traditional appearance that lots of property owners favor, while metal roofing comes in numerous designs and colors, permitting even more modification.

Last but not least, review insulation and energy efficiency. Metal roofs mirror warm, keeping your home cooler, while tiles might take in more warm, impacting your power bills.

Inevitably, consider these variables against your budget plan, regional climate, and personal preferences to make the best roofing selection for your home.
